So if I had a SS amp rated at 8 ohms output, it would in principle still be safe to run a 4 ohm cab with it?
- new05002
- IAMILFFAMOUS

- Posts: 3870
- Joined: Thu Aug 04, 2011 1:07 pm
Re: The Doom Room: ILF Edition
generally its okay but u are putting added stress on the power amp. If its designed not to really run below 8 ohms then that would be the case

new05002 wrote:radish wrote:It is great to see that the doom room is still alive. I used to post in the HC one on occasion.
I desperately need to replace the tubes in my Electric amp. Has anyone ever tried 6ca7s in place of el34s? They have piqued my interest.
yes I have and they are really nice. I have used the JJ 6ca7s and i love them. Also to my knowledge Conky has used the EHX 6ca7s and he likes them as well. Drop in replacements with just a rebias
